What Are Common Signs Of A Failing Bmw X6 Valve Cover?

When the BMW X6 valve cover starts to go bad, you’ll probably spot oily spots around the engine, maybe even find oil pooling up where it shouldn’t be. A sharp, burnt oil smell might hang around after you park, sometimes with wisps of smoke sneaking from under the hood. Engine performance can feel off—it loses some punch, runs rough, or you hear a soft ticking noise that wasn’t there before. Often, the check engine light tags along, triggered by leaks or misfires thanks to a cracked or warped cover. If any of these show up, check the BMW X6 valve cover and gaskets soon before things spiral into a bigger mess.

How Long Does It Take To Replace A Bmw X6 Valve Cover?

Swapping out a BMW X6 valve cover runs around three to five hours for someone with some solid wrench time. You’ll have to move a few engine parts out of the way, clean things up, and set the new cover in place with care. Sometimes it goes faster with a good set of tools, but speed isn’t everything—going slow helps make sure the seal stays tight. If there’s sludge or other gunk lurking underneath, it might stretch out the job. Less handy folks might want to hand off the job to a seasoned mechanic, since they can usually wrap things up without drama.

What Causes Oil Leaks From The Bmw X6 Valve Cover?

Most oil leaks coming from the BMW X6 valve cover boil down to the gasket getting stiff or cracked with age. The rubber gets baked by the engine heat, or goes brittle from old oil, and pretty soon oil slips past the seal. A cover that’s warped or cracked from being overtightened will cause leaks too. Clogged PCV systems bring extra crankcase pressure, and that’s all it takes for oil to start looking for a way out. Inspect the cover and gasket from time to time and swap them when needed to keep leaks from showing up.

Is It Safe To Drive With A Damaged Bmw X6 Valve Cover?

Hitting the road with a wrecked BMW X6 valve cover isn’t a great call. Even a slow leak can drip oil onto hot surfaces, raising the odds of smoke or—if it’s really bad—an engine fire. Cracks or loose spots in the cover let grit and dust inside, which chews up engine parts over time. Maybe you make it to the shop before things get worse, but waiting too long can turn a minor problem into major headaches and costs. Get any BMW X6 valve cover issues sorted out quick to keep your engine safe and your drives worry-free.

How Much Does It Cost To Replace The Bmw X6 Valve Cover?

The price tag on a BMW X6 valve cover swap isn’t set in stone. OEM and aftermarket parts can run $150 to $350, then add in $300 to $600 for labor, give or take for where you are and who’s doing the work. If the shop finds extra problems—maybe bad ignition coils or worn grommets—costs climb. Doing it solo helps your wallet, but only if you stick close to the repair guidelines. All said and done, most people end up spending $450 to $950 when leaving the job to the pros.
